Activity Reviews

Great experience whether you are single or in a group, and great for any age. The whole process is very streamlined and coordinated. We were given a tour of the local market to start with, before going to the guides' family home and learning about the culture and foods. A lot of the staff do the prep work, so if you're looking for something intensive, this may not be for you. But we got to use traditional methods and were given tips on how to select products for quality and freshness. We made at least 8 different dishes. It was so much fun learning the methods for cooking balinese dishes. Staff were professional, friendly, and helpful! The meal was delicious, and we were given a cookbook with all of the recipes we made!
